Located in the heart of Namaqualand, Nababeep Hills Guest House has a long tradition of hospitality. Originally built in 1968 by O’Kiep Copper Company as a guest house for the guests of the copper mines, it is part of a one-hectare property which also housed the General Manager of the mines.
